3. Getting Ready for Your Interviews

Success at Irving Shipbuilding requires a blend of technical depth and a disciplined, process-oriented mindset. You should prepare to demonstrate not just your ability to code, but your ability to engineer solutions that are robust, maintainable, and aligned with industrial standards.

Technical Rigor – We look for engineers who understand the "why" behind their technical choices. Be ready to discuss the trade-offs of your past implementations and how you ensure reliability in your software.

Systems Thinking – You will often work in environments where software interacts with physical hardware and industrial processes. Demonstrate your ability to consider the broader system architecture rather than focusing solely on isolated software modules.

Safety and Quality Focus – In a shipbuilding environment, precision is paramount. You must be able to articulate how your development practices—such as testing, code reviews, and documentation—contribute to the overall safety and quality of the final product.

8. Frequently Asked Questions

Q: How long should I spend preparing for the interview? A: Dedicate at least 1–2 weeks to reviewing your past technical projects and aligning your experience with the specific domain of the role (e.g., security or production engineering).

Q: Is the interview process mostly technical or behavioral? A: It is a balanced mix. You must be technically competent to pass the screen, but your ability to work within a team and handle complex project requirements is equally important.

Q: Does Irving Shipbuilding offer flexibility in work location? A: Most roles for this position are site-specific, given the nature of the shipyard environment. Be sure to confirm the specific location requirements for your role during the initial screening.

9. Other General Tips

  • Structure your answers: Use the STAR method (Situation, Task, Action, Result) to keep your behavioral answers focused and impactful.
  • Know your resume: Be prepared to explain the technical details of every project you have listed.
  • Ask thoughtful questions: Use the end of the interview to ask about current projects or the team's biggest technical challenges.
